☠️ Is That Email Really From Amazon? ???? (Probably a Scam!)
You get an email claiming it's from Amazon. Your account has been compromised, and you need to confirm your information immediately. Sounds sketchy, right? It probably might be a scam!
Scammers are getting sophisticated with their emails, trying to deceive you into giving them your login details. Always confirm the sender's address and be wary of immediate requests for data.
- Never click links or attachments in suspicious emails.
- Visit Amazon's site directly by typing the URL into your browser.
- Flag any spammy emails to Amazon.
Watch Out For Scammer Red Flags!
Staying safe online demands staying alert to potential scams. Scammers are becoming sophisticated, making it harder to spot their tricks. But don't worry, you can find ways to keep your information secure. Here are some important red flags to watch out for:
- Unrealistic offers that seem too good to be true. This could involve promises of quick riches or deals that are much lower than the market rate.
- {Pressure tactics to act immediately. Scammers will try to urgency to make you give in quickly. Don't let them rush you!
- Requests for personal information that seem unusual. Such as never give out your social security number, bank details, or passwords over email or phone unless you are completely certain you're dealing with a legitimate company.
